Output 99ac63c6399b7047f603b7f7a2c92ea68564eadc27fa11238e84fe4c4ac14e69:21

value
80558
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d9592168c5b7e12f1cdd7a8a6c88c974a9f25311 OP_EQUALVERIFY OP_CHECKSIG
address
1LpEQXME59fRtwqerGaH7GzqN4tehnu9DY
transaction
99ac63c6399b7047f603b7f7a2c92ea68564eadc27fa11238e84fe4c4ac14e69
confirmations
134339
spent
true